Today in B4, we worked in
groups to perform our own news reports based on key events from The
1,000-Year-Old Boy. Each group took on the role of TV reporters, anchors, and
eyewitnesses to retell parts of the story as if they were breaking news.
We performed five reports
in sequence about the fire in the woods, the missing boy Alfie, the tragic
death of his mother, Alfie being found safe, and finally a community vigil
remembering his mum.
The activity helped us to
explore character emotions, practise expression and tone, and use formal
language for reporting. It also supported our understanding of structure,
perspective, and how information is presented to an audience.
